On November 23, 2014, Taylor Swift performed "Blank Space" at the American Music Awards, a pivotal moment in her career. This performance came shortly after the release of her fifth studio album, "1989," which had debuted only a few weeks earlier on October 27, 2014. The album marked a significant shift in Swift's musical style, transitioning from country to pop, and "Blank Space" quickly became one of its standout tracks. The performance at the AMAs highlighted her new image and sound, showcasing her ability to captivate audiences with elaborate visuals and a commanding stage presence. Notably, this era solidified her status as a leading figure in the pop music industry, with "Blank Space" later receiving multiple nominations and awards, underscoring the impact of her reinvented artistry during this time.
